  1. Just do remember that Essential Oils are concentrated and not all brands can be applied to the skin without use of a carrier oil. When used neat, one drop is totally enough! and even then it depends on the individual. Some people cannot tolerate all oils. ie they will react ok with one and very negatively with another. My son has always been that way. Just because something is natural doesn't always mean it doesn't have a potential for reactivity. We learned that the hard way and with much trial and error. It's the same with supplements....they are excellent and beneficial - but different people have different reactions.

  5. Yes, chlorine was a major tic trigger for my son! Even though it didn't show in his list of actual allergies, more detailed testing showed he was very very sensitive to it, as to many other chemicals. Later testing confirmed he has MCS (Multiple Chemical Sensitivity) which is why both environmental and food additive chemicals impact him so intensely, including chemical perfumed/fragranced items etc I found some excellent online resources over the years to make my own household products, and always select fragrance free/dye free options for laundry, toiletries etc and of course no artificial food dyes or other artificial food additives.
